黑狐家游戏

英文网站导航源码详解与实战应用,英文网站导航 源码下载

欧气 1 0

本文目录导读:

  1. 导航系统的设计原则
  2. 英文网站导航源码的实现方式
  3. 实战应用案例

在当今数字化时代,网站的导航系统扮演着至关重要的角色,它不仅能够提升用户体验,还能够有效引导访客浏览和探索网站内容,本文将深入探讨英文网站导航源码的设计理念、实现方式以及在实际项目中的应用。

导航系统的设计原则

用户友好性

导航系统应确保用户能够轻松找到所需信息,这包括简洁明了的标签、清晰的层级结构以及易于访问的关键功能。

灵活性

随着网站内容的不断更新和扩展,导航系统需要具备足够的灵活性来适应这些变化,动态添加或删除菜单项的能力。

英文网站导航源码详解与实战应用,英文网站导航 源码下载

图片来源于网络,如有侵权联系删除

可维护性

良好的代码结构和注释有助于团队成员之间的协作和维护工作,使用模块化和可重用的组件也有助于提高开发效率。

性能优化

大型网站的导航系统可能会对性能产生影响,我们需要考虑如何优化加载速度和提高响应时间。

英文网站导航源码的实现方式

HTML结构

HTML是构建导航系统的基石,以下是一个简单的英文网站导航示例:

<nav>
    <ul class="nav-menu">
        <li><a href="#home">Home</a></li>
        <li><a href="#about">About Us</a></li>
        <li><a href="#services">Services</a></li>
        <li><a href="#contact">Contact</a></li>
    </ul>
</nav>

在这个例子中,我们创建了一个<nav>元素作为容器,并在其中嵌套了一个无序列表(<ul>)来表示不同的导航项。

CSS样式

CSS用于美化导航栏的外观和行为,以下是一些基本的样式设置:

.nav-menu {
    list-style-type: none;
    padding: 0;
    margin: 0;
}
.nav-menu li {
    display: inline-block;
    margin-right: 20px;
}
.nav-menu a {
    text-decoration: none;
    color: #333;
}

这里我们设置了列表项为水平排列,并且去掉了默认的列表标记,我们还给链接添加了去除下划线的样式。

英文网站导航源码详解与实战应用,英文网站导航 源码下载

图片来源于网络,如有侵权联系删除

JavaScript交互

JavaScript可以用来增强导航的功能,比如实现下拉菜单或其他交互效果,以下是一个简单的下拉菜单示例:

document.addEventListener("DOMContentLoaded", function() {
    var dropdowns = document.querySelectorAll(".dropdown");
    for (var i = 0; i < dropdowns.length; i++) {
        dropdowns[i].addEventListener("click", function(event) {
            event.preventDefault();
            this.classList.toggle("active");
        });
    }
});

这段代码监听了所有带有类名“dropdown”的元素的点击事件,当某个元素被点击时,它会切换自己的状态类以显示或隐藏子菜单。

实战应用案例

网站实例分析

以某知名科技博客为例,其导航系统采用了多层级的下拉菜单设计,既保证了信息的丰富性,又保持了界面的整洁美观,通过合理的布局和清晰的分类,该网站使得用户能够迅速定位到感兴趣的文章和技术资讯。

项目实践

在实际项目中,我们可以借鉴上述经验并结合自身需求进行定制化开发,对于电子商务平台来说,购物车功能和促销活动的实时展示可能是关键点;而对于教育机构而言,课程目录和学习资源的便捷查找则更为重要。

英文网站导航源码的设计与实现是一项复杂而细致的工作,它不仅涉及到前端技术的综合运用,还需要充分考虑用户体验和市场需求的动态变化,在未来发展中,随着移动设备的普及和物联网技术的发展,我们对导航系统的要求也将越来越高,持续学习和创新是我们不断前进的动力源泉。

标签: #英文网站导航 源码

黑狐家游戏
  • 评论列表

留言评论